Why Inflation is Your Biggest Threat to Employee Retention?

According to the Philippine Statistics Authority, overall prices for everyday goods and services continue to rise, affecting how Filipino households stretch their income. Even though headline inflation has eased at times in 2025, key cost drivers like food and transportation have shown persistent upward pressure, meaning workers must spend more of their budget on essentials. 

For example, in September  2025, headline inflation nationwide was 1.7% year‑on‑year, with both food and transport prices contributing to the increase, reflecting ongoing cost‑of‑living challenges for households. 

These price increases directly influence workers’ day‑to‑day decisions: choosing between essential expenses such as food, transport, utilities, and savings, or delaying critical needs like healthcare and education. For many employees, the rising cost of living without a corresponding increase in take‑home pay creates financial stress that can lead to burnout and turnover.

From Bills to Burnout: The Domino Effect of Financial Stress

Financial anxiety manifests in ways that directly impact your bottom line:

  • Increased absenteeism: Employees take emergency leave to handle urgent money matters
  • Presenteeism: They’re physically at work but mentally preoccupied, leading to costly mistakes and missed deadlines
  • Vulnerability to predatory lending: Desperate for cash, they turn to “5-6” lenders, deepening their stress each month
  • Turnover acceleration: Financially stressed employees constantly scan job boards, making them flight risks you can’t afford to lose

A recent wellness survey shows that financial stress isn’t just a personal issue; it affects health, relationships, and work outcomes. Employees experiencing high levels of financial stress are significantly more likely to report mental and physical health symptoms, such as headaches, fatigue, mood swings, and sleep problems: factors that undermine productivity and engagement at work.

Earned Wage Access (EWA) is the most powerful application of this concept. Think of it like a faucet for earned salary. Instead of waiting for the traditional flood of cash on the 15th and 30th, your employees can access a steady stream of wages they’ve already earned, exactly when they need it.

This is crucial: EWA is not a loan. There’s no interest charged, no credit check required, no debt being created. It’s simply giving employees access to compensation they’ve already worked for, on their own terms.
